Key Takeaways

  • Leading an organization requires leadership, relationship-building, and communication skills working together.
  • Communication is a key component of effective leadership, enabling teams to collaborate toward a common goal.
  • Relationship-building skills apply at the organizational level to both internal and external relationships.
  • Effective leaders encourage and support employees to cultivate hungry leaders rather than passive followers.
  • Leadership skills learned can be taught onward to department heads and employees.
